Summary: | A method is proposed for estimating the lift and hinge-moment parameters of lifting surfaces with and without sweep. The method is based upon lift predictions presented in NACA Report 921, 1948 and upon estimates of the induced-camber aspect-ratio corrections to the hinge-moment parameters computed from a solution of the chordwise loading by the Falkner method. Design charts for the induced-camber correction are provided so that the method may be applied without extensive computations of the surface loading. The theoretical results are compared with expermental results for four horizontal-tail models without sweepback and for five horizontal-tail models with sweepback. |
